2025-11-20 06:44:24
oct是八进制的缩写,进制八进制就是数字0到7,超过7的数要用两位表示。比如数字8在八进制里写成10,数字9写成11,数字15写成17。计算机用八进制主要是早期内存管理方便,因为8是2的三次方,和二进制转换更直接。
进制八进制为什么是这个答案呢?首先得明白进制就是计数规则,十进制用0-9,二进制用0-1。八进制刚好是2的三次方,所以每三位二进制数能对应一个八进制数。比如二进制110是十进制的6,八进制就是6;二进制1100是十进制的12,八进制就是14。早期计算机用八进制记录地址,比如用7位二进制表示128个地址,刚好对应八进制的0到77。现在编程里还能看到,比如C语言用0o123表示八进制数,0o10等于十进制的8。不过现在更多用十六进制,因为16是2的四次方,和二进制转换更灵活。比如十六进制的FF等于十进制的255,而八进制的377才是255。所以oct就是八进制,数字范围0-7,逢八进一,和二进制、十六进制一样都是计算机基础计数方式。
本题链接: